The quickest way to compare insurance rates is by going online to get the rates from several companies all at once. However, there are many people that are fearful of providing information while on a website, but it is possible to get an insurance quote no personal info needed.
There are several sites that will request specific information such as your name, date of birth, address and vehicle information. This is necessary in order to give you an accurate rate regarding the type of insurance being sought, however, they do not typically ask for information such as your social security number. Most sites also have an optional area for entering your phone number. It is important to note that if you do enter a phone number, you could begin receiving several calls per day from other companies offering to write you a policy.
To begin a search for online quotes, in the search box type in online insurance quotes. Several different companies will be provided. Choose at least three different insurance companies or choose a site that will give you several options based on a small questionnaire.
The questionnaire will ask you basic questions, such as your name, the state where you reside, the type of vehicle you drive and how many miles are on the vehicle. The short questionnaire will then email you or bring up a box with several companies to choose from. Always enter the true state in which you live, some companies offer discounts for various states that have a lower risk for damage.
Go to the site for the companies you have selected and fill out their questionnaire for online quotes. Be honest with the type of vehicle, mileage and year in order to get the closest dollar amount of what a policy may cost. Many of the insurance companies will ask for an email address in order to send the information requested to you for further review.
Getting an insurance quote no personal info needed will most likely not give you an exact amount the policy would cost, but it will give you enough general information to extend the search for a particular companies prices. Always compare at least three companies and read the terms carefully. Prices will vary according to deductibles and amount of coverage. There are also several discounts available through insurance companies such as age, students in school and how far you drive the vehicle daily, weekly or yearly. Again, read the quote presented to you completely before making a decision.
